Why Authentic New York-Style Slices Hit Different


If you love pizza in Pompano Beach but feel like it all blends together, a true New York-style slice can be a wake-up call. It has a clear “anatomy” that sets it apart:


  • A crust that is thin, foldable, and slightly crisp at the edge 
  • Tomato sauce that tastes bright and savory, not heavy 
  • Real mozzarella that melts smoothly and stretches when you pull a slice 
  • Toppings that go from edge to edge, not clumped in the center 


When you pick up a slice like that, you know it right away. It bends just enough to fold, but the tip does not flop onto the plate. You can smell the fresh-baked dough and the tomato sauce as soon as it comes out of the box or out of the oven at the table.


The whole experience feels more satisfying. You get that first cheese pull, then a bite where crust, sauce, cheese, and toppings are all in perfect balance. Over time, this style becomes the one you compare every other pizza to.
